Ingredients List
Cottage Cheese: The star of the show! Choose low-fat or fat-free cottage cheese for a lighter option. Its creamy texture adds richness to the dip while packing a protein punch.
Cream Cheese: This ingredient brings a velvety smoothness and richness to the dip, balancing the tanginess of the cottage cheese. Use light cream cheese for a healthier twist.
Shredded Cheddar Cheese: A classic choice for queso, it adds sharpness and flavor. Feel free to substitute with a vegan cheese blend for a dairy-free option.
Diced Tomatoes with Green Chilies: These provide a zesty kick along with natural sweetness. You can swap them for fresh tomatoes and jalapeños if you prefer a fresher taste.
Garlic Powder: A must for an aromatic flavor base that enhances the overall depth of the dip. Fresh minced garlic is an excellent alternative.
Onion Powder: This adds a savory profile without the texture of chopped onions, making it smoother. You might substitute it with fresh onions for a more pronounced flavor.
Cumin: Adds warmth and earthiness reminiscent of traditional queso dips. Omit if you want a milder flavor.
Salt and Pepper: To season to taste, enhancing all other flavors. Adjust according to dietary preferences.
Optional Toppings: Chopped cilantro, sliced jalapeños, or a sprinkle of paprika can elevate the dish visually and flavor-wise.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Gather Your Ingredients
Start by gathering all your ingredients. This will streamline the cooking process and ensure you have everything at hand.
Step 2: Blend the Cottage Cheese
In a blender or food processor, add in 1 cup of cottage cheese along with the 4 ounces of cream cheese. Blend until the mixture is uniform and creamy. If you prefer a chunkier dip, pulse it briefly instead.
Step 3: Mix in the Cheeses
Transfer the blended mixture into a mixing bowl and add 1 cup of shredded cheddar cheese. Stir well to combine, making sure the cheese is evenly distributed.
Step 4: Add Tomatoes and Seasonings
Next, fold in the 1 can (10 oz) of diced tomatoes with green chilies, 1 teaspoon of garlic powder, 1 teaspoon of onion powder, and 1 teaspoon of cumin.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Mix until everything is well incorporated.
Step 5: Heat the Mixture
Pour the mixture into a saucepan over medium heat. Stir frequently until the dip is hot and the cheeses have melted, typically about 5-10 minutes.
Step 6: Serve Immediately
Once heated, transfer your Cottage Cheese Queso Dip to a serving bowl. Add your optional toppings, like chopped cilantro or sliced jalapeños, and serve warm with tortilla chips or fresh vegetable sticks.

Nutritional Value / Health Benefits
Protein Power: Cottage cheese delivers about 28 grams of protein per cup, which aids muscle recovery and promotes satiety.
Low Fat Content: Using low-fat ingredients significantly reduces the calorie count, making it a perfect guilt-free indulgence.
Calcium-Rich: Essential for bone health, cottage cheese is a good source of calcium, supporting overall skeletal health.
Vitamins: The tomatoes and chilies bring vitamins A and C to the table, which help support your immune system and skin health.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Skipping the Blending Step: Not blending the cottage cheese thoroughly can lead to a chunky dip rather than a smooth consistency.
Overheating: Cooking the dip too long can cause the cheese to become stringy. Heat slowly and stir frequently.
Under-seasoning: Be generous with the spices! Not seasoning properly can lead to a bland dip. Always taste as you go.
Storing Tips
Refrigerate: Store leftover dip in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.
Freeze: You can freeze the dip for up to 2 months, but it may change the texture slightly upon thawing. Reheat gently.
Reheat Gently: When reheating, do so on low heat to maintain the creamy consistency, stirring until smooth.

Cottage Cheese Queso Dip
- Total Time: 20 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
A healthier twist on traditional queso dip using cottage cheese for a rich, creamy texture and a protein boost.
Ingredients
- 1 cup cottage cheese (low-fat or fat-free)
- 4 ounces cream cheese (light recommended)
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ese (or vegan cheese blend)
- 1 can (10 oz) diced tomatoes with green chilies
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Optional toppings: Chopped cilantro, sliced jalapeños, paprika
Instructions
- Gather your ingredients.
- Blend the cottage cheese and cream cheese until smooth.
- Mix in the shredded cheddar cheese.
- Add the diced tomatoes, garlic powder, onion powder, cumin, salt, and pepper. Mix well.
- Heat the mixture in a saucepan over medium heat until hot and the cheeses melt.
- Serve warm with optional toppings and tortilla chips or fresh veggie sticks.
Notes
Use Greek yogurt instead of cream cheese for extra protein.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
